It is quite obvious that, under such circumstances, a number of superficial, imperfect, and distorted observations crept into the theoretic system of natural science.
However, this was not all; the diagnostico-theoretical method, by means of which antiquity, the middle ages, and even the greatest part of more modern times, had seen the natural sciences treated, was radically wrong. Man did not feel his way carefully from experiment to experiment, from observation to observation, until the general principle was found which inductively comprised a number of phenomena under one uniform principle of law, but the principle which was at the bottom of phenomena was fixed upon a speculative basis, and in accordance with this principle the phenomena were interpreted—as was done, for instance, in medicine in the case of humoral pathology. And as this speculatively constructed principle was obtained exclusively by a method dangerous to the cognition of natural sciences, by conclusion from analogy, naturally the most fantastic and adventurous conceptions soon became accepted in the realm of natural philosophy. But natural philosophy once lost in such a labyrinth, an aberration of the perceptive powers can not fail to follow—at least, in certain domains of nature. As a matter of fact, this fallacious perception promptly made its appearance, and has proved the stumbling-block of science from its earliest days up to the present times. Occultism, mysticism, or whatever the names may be of the various forms of superstition, have sprung from these erroneous conceptions of natural science. It may even be contended that no variety of superstition exists which is not somehow connected with a distorted observation or explanation of nature. We can here consider only those relations which prevail, or have prevailed, between superstition and natural science, and principally the influence which was thus exerted upon the art of healing by astronomy.
Astronomy and medicine became most intimately connected during the earliest periods of human civilization. The literature of cuneiform inscriptions shows us that the attempt to bring the stars into connection with human destinies is primeval, and reaches back to the ancient Babylonian age, even to the Sumero-Accadic period (Sudhoff, Med. Woche. 1901, No. 41). How primeval peoples came to connect their destinies with the heavenly bodies and their orbits is explained so lucidly by Troels-Lund (page 28, etc.) that we shall cite his descriptions, even if they are rather long for quotation. He says: “The Chaldean history of creation is inscribed upon seven clay tablets. On the fifth tablet we read: ‘The seventh day He instituted as a holy day, and ordained that man should rest from all labor.’ Why just seven? Because the holy number seven of the planets imperceptibly shone through the work of creation, and was imperceptibly impressed upon the entire order of thought. We are here at the decisive epoch at which the planets for the first time gave an impetus to human conception, the effects of which were to persist for thousands of years. This was repeated a second time when Copernicus, in dealing especially with the orbit of the planets, founded the still-prevailing conception of the universe.
“For the theory of creation could be reconciled with the phenomenon of sun and moon moving in their regular courses. They were in this case no longer, as had been assumed until then, individual living beings and divinities, but lights kindled by a mighty God, and intended to move day and night, in an established order, under the dome of heaven. But the other five planets! It was unnecessary to be a Chaldean on the Babylonian Tower in order to feel amazement at these. Every one who had ever followed with his eye their courses for a few nights during a caravan journey, every one who, lying awake, had occasionally attempted to read the time from the only clock of the night—the star-covered canopy of heaven—was bound to have noticed their peculiarities as to light and course. They did not shine uniformly, but sometimes intensely, at other times faintly, and entirely different was their radiance from that of other stars—reddish, greenish, bluish. And their course was at one time rapid, at other times slow; then backward or oblique; sometimes they disappeared entirely. Necessarily they appeared inexplicable not only to the inexperienced observer, but to a still higher grade of intellect—that of the most experienced Chaldean; for, altho their periods could possibly be calculated, their courses beggared all geometrical figures. These confused paths could be explained only in one manner—namely, as the expression of an arbitrary will, the manifestations of an independent life. The courses of the planets furnished the astronomic proof that the heavenly bodies were animated. The universe was more than created, it was godhead itself in living activity.
“How this point of view broadened and cleared everything! The world assumed the shape of an enormous hall upon which divine power, divine will, continuously acted from above. Farthest down was the world of the elements. In boundless distances above it moved the moon and the six other planets, each one in its transparent heaven. In the highest height, finally, revolved the canopy of impervious heaven, into which constellations were ranged in shapes that resembled animals (Tablet V., verse 2). Apparently these rotations did not have anything in common with each other; a power which passed through them from above moved these elemental worlds. Did not daily experience of their rising determine winter, storm, drought, etc.? Thus the processes on earth only reflected and repeated the course of these divine and heavenly bodies; yea, divine will itself. But their order of movement varied. Sun and moon with their regular courses spin, as it were, the firm warps and woofs; the other five are instrumental in producing what is changeable and apparently accidental. Unitedly in their course through heaven the seven weave the threads of fate. Silently they weave the design of terrestrial life. Upon them depend not only summer and winter, rain and drought, but also the life and death of every living being; as determined by the constellation of their birth, such is each man, so will he live. Never do the heavenly bodies repeat precisely the same relative positions, and, therefore, never are two years, two days, two human beings, two leaves, completely identical.”
So far Troels-Lund.
Much as we agree with what Troels-Lund says, yet we believe that the decisive motive which led humanity to bring their bodily welfare into closest connection with the starry canopy of heaven was suggested by the powerful influence which the sun exerts upon the bodily welfare of all life. As this life-giving power of the sun had a conspicuous share in the origin of primeval sabianism, so also it exerted a similar influence upon the development of astrology; for it must have been obvious to even the most stupid observer that his well-being depended to a great extent upon the action of the sun. From this perception to the idea that other heavenly bodies were also intended to exert a decisive influence upon things terrestrial was only a short step for the ancient civilized peoples; for here the conclusion from analogy was actually so closely and so enticingly under every one’s nose that all he had to do was but to pitch upon the powers which rule all earthly life and neatly box them up in a well-constructed system. But as the conclusion from analogy was always considered in the ancient world as the most certain, never-failing path to knowledge, it was readily followed in this connection also. And thus astrology, like the greater part of medico-physical knowledge, was based, we think, upon the treacherous ground of a conclusion per analogiam.
